Hi,

Please wait. I expect to have a fix by Monday. Meanwhile, a workaround:

Prerequisite: USB keyboard

  1. Power on the device
  2. Wait 5 full minutes (about the time it takes for the device to normally boot)
  3. Hit Ctrl+D on the keyboard

The device will finish booting within a couple seconds

Note: Be sure the keyboard is plugged into the USB port closest to the network port.

Update: I installed full Wikipedia and could still reboot RACHEL, so I installed en-kolibri and en-kolibri-channel-ck-12, and I can still reboot. Iā€™m up to 322G (37%) used, but I canā€™t test the workaround yet. Iā€™ll add et-videos and learn-saylor next.

@Steve Whatā€™s the status of your permanent fix?

After adding en-etvideos, en-learnsaylor and en-saylor, I could still reboot, so I then added en-etbooks, en-radiolab and en-TED. With these modules, I have used 512G (59%) of RACHELā€™s capacity, and she doesnā€™t fully reboot without the workaround, but booting her with a USB keyboard connected and pressing Ctrl-D after five minutes does enable wifi. I repeated the new reboot sequence twice.

To recap, I now have the modules above plus the following modules installed.

en-wikipedia
en-kolibri
en-kolibri-channel-ck-12
en-kolibri-channel-sikana
en-etvideos
en-learn-saylor
en-saylor
en-etbooks
en-radiolab
en-TED

With all but the last three of these modules, I could reboot without the keyboard workaround. After adding the last three, I can reboot only with the workaround.
